There are a number of L5S bodies in the Showcase right now with no control or 3-way controls so you can order those drilled as you wish. Sometimes there are options that don't pop up if you order from the webpage, so call them.
 
Another option, for the brave, is to drill your own 1/2 in. hole in the upper horn. I did it, copying CB, on my thinline tele. You solder the switch connectors then run it through the f-hole into the right spot using a thread or wire.

Just in an old DIY Finishing thread; it's in a box in the basement, 1st round I got the gold top perfect, but screwed up scraping the binding; 2nd round I tried to respray the gold top without redoing the primer, that didn't work, 3rd round I took the top back to bare wood, re-primered but tried to shoot the gold top paint when the temperature was just marginally warm enough, and that didn't work. It's hard to tell from that pic, but there are areas in which the gold top paint isn't uniformly the same color, you just can't spray that stuff unless it's 75 degrees Fahrenheit or better or it won't flow/setup right.
